Time to Maintain

When your needs are small, taking care of your own trucks is rather easy, but if you have expanding needs, it can become a nightmare. When you lease or rent, you can opt for dealer maintenance which allows you to worry about other more important matters. For example, if a truck breaks down, you’ll be able to get a fast replacement. On the other hand, if you only have your own trucks and one breaks down, you’ll be down a truck. Rental trucks allow you the peace of mind of having a capable truck without the worries of it nickel-and-diming you to death with both repair time and money.

Buying Used Trucks

Of course there are always the tried and tested trucks of last year, or last decade, which are still quite capable of heavy duty work. Rental trucks often get retired and come up for sale on lots. This can be a bit of a gamble though, as used vehicle buying always is. You don’t know the specific work history of these trucks. It’s also not likely that every former client will openly and honestly share every single detail of the strains and stresses any particular truck is put through.
